How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 77315?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 77315 Studio Apartments | $1,646 | $1,646 | $1,646 |
| 77315 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,053 | $614 | $1,435 |
| 77315 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,307 | $904 | $1,880 |
| 77315 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,696 | $1,316 | $2,049 |
| 77315 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,465 | $1,465 | $1,465 |
